Read more +Oct 11, 2019· Basic Machining Practices. The basic machining practices aCNC machineoperator must master include shop safety, shop math, blueprint reading, tolerance interpretation and measuring devices. These topics are commonly considered prerequisite toCNC training. Externaltrainingresources typically begin with shop safety.

Read more +G-Code is the language used to controlCNC machines. It’s one type ofCNCprogramming thatCNCprogrammers use, the other type being CAM programming. CAM programs will generate g-code from a CAD drawing, but the end result is still g-code. Yourmachine’sCNCcontroller probably executes g-code, although there are other possibilities ...
